KOBOLD Instruments, Inc. OME - Helical Gear Flowmeter

Product Features Economical High Precision ± 0.3% of Flow Advanced Helical-Gear Technology Quiet Operation Viscous Media to 5000 cSt Self-Cleaning KOBOLD's new OME positive displacement flowmeter breaks through the price barrier for meters incorporating helical-gear technology. The OME provides the quiet, non-pulsating, low pressure-loss operation for which helical gears are renowned, at a price comparable to oval-gear technology. The OME is designed to be used with non-abrasive, lubricating liquids whose viscosity lies in the range of 1 - 5000 cSt. The precision and reliability of the device is equivalent to our top-of-the-line OME helical-gear meters. . . no performance sacrifices have been made. In a design diverging from conventional systems, the rotation of the OME's helical gears is detected by externally mounted proximity switches. This not only reduces the unit's price, but also makes a second sensor possible for little additional cost. This second (optional) sensor may be used for detection of flow direction or frequency multiplication. The standard sensor is amplified by a PNP collector circuit. An optional NAMUR output is available.
